On Fri, 2 May 2008, Alexy Khrabrov wrote:

> I have an UPDATE query updating a 100 million row table, and
> allocate enough memory via shared_buffers=1500MB.

In addition to reducing that as you've been advised, you'll probably need
to increase checkpoint_segments significantly from the default (3) in
order to get good performance on an update that large.  Something like 30
would be a reasonable starting point.

I'd suggest doing those two things, seeing how things go, and reporting
back if you still think performance is unacceptable.  We'd need to know
your PostgreSQL version in order to really target future suggestions.
